uluwatu
Pura Luhur Uluwatu is a temple area located on a cliff. This is one of the most famous tourist destinations in Bali. Incredible cliff views, the presence of very interactive monkeys, and also the incredible sunset view at Uluwatu temple makes it all feel very extraordinary. This area offers beautiful and unique views of the Luhur Uluwatu temple which is located at the end of a cliff of coral hills. It looks very exotic and attractive, located at an altitude of 97 meters above sea level. This sacred place for Hindus is also part of a must-visit tourist attraction, especially for the first time on vacation on the island of the Gods, Bali. This place is also very famous for the Kecak dance performances that feature the Ramayana story.
uluwatu
The Kecak and Fire Dance is performed on an open/outdoor circular stage right next to Uluwatu Temple. The view of the cliffs is so very enchanting coupled with the panoramic sunset that is so beautiful makes this place very famous for domestic and foreign tourists. The story of the Uluwatu Kecak dance is taken from the Ramayana story which tells of a very wise King named Sang Rama Dewa who is trying to save his consort “Dewi Sita” He was kidnapped by a very evil giant king named Ravana. In order to find and save his wife, King Rama took a long and very dangerous journey accompanied only by his younger brother, Laksamana.
